After all grape leaves are packed into the pot, add ½ cup water to the pot, along with about ½ cup fresh lemon juice. Set … Depending on your climate, pick grape leaves in late spring (May or June). Select whole leaves, free of damage, from vines that have not been sprayed with pesticides. Leaves should display a light green color and have a supple texture. Seek out the best picks just below the new growth at the top of the … See more To prepare leaves for blanching, use a sharp knife or scissors to cut the stem off of each leaf. Then, rinse well under cold running water. To blanch, boil water in a teakettle. So, folk wisdom says that tannins help keep cucumbers and other veggies crispy as they ferment in a brine. But, I've noticed that grape leaves in particular become quickly coated in a white film and this seems to make the brine extra cloudy and unappealing looking. Also seems to make it have way more scum on top of the whole lot. elisabeth claussenWebMay 29, 2024 · Blanch the Grape Leaves: Fresh grape leaves should be blanched before using.
